Metal roof replacement services involve removing an existing roof and installing a new metal roofing system on a property. This process typically includes inspecting the current roof, preparing the surface, and carefully installing durable metal panels designed to last for decades. The service ensures that the new roof is properly sealed and secured, providing a reliable barrier against weather elements and helping to improve the overall safety and appearance of the property.
This service addresses a variety of common roofing problems, such as extensive rust, persistent leaks, or damage caused by severe weather events. Over time, metal roofs can develop issues like loose panels, corrosion, or warping, which compromise their effectiveness. Replacing an aging or damaged roof with a new metal system can resolve these issues, preventing further damage to the underlying structure and reducing the likelihood of costly repairs down the line.
Properties that often utilize metal roof replacement services include residential homes, especially those with older roofs showing signs of wear. Commercial buildings, such as warehouses or retail spaces, also frequently opt for metal roofing to ensure durability and low maintenance. Additionally, agricultural facilities like barns and storage sheds often benefit from metal roof replacements due to their exposure to the elements and the need for long-lasting protection.
Homeowners and property managers might consider a metal roof replacement when their current roofing system has reached the end of its lifespan or is no longer performing effectively. Signs that a replacement may be needed include visible rust, missing or damaged panels, frequent leaks, or increased energy costs. The overview below groups typical Metal Roof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- minor metal roof repairs, such as fixing leaks or replacing damaged panels, typically cost between $250 and $600. Many routine repairs fall within this range, though costs can vary based on the extent of damage and material type.
Partial Replacement - replacing sections of a metal roof or upgrading specific areas generally ranges from $1,000 to $3,500. Local contractors often handle these projects with costs depending on the size and complexity of the area being replaced.
Full Roof Replacement - a complete metal roof replacement usually falls between $5,000 and $15,000. Many full replacements are in the middle of this range, but larger or more intricate projects can exceed $20,000 in some cases.
Complex or Large-Scale Projects - extensive or custom metal roofing projects can reach $20,000 or more, especially for large commercial buildings or roofs with special features. These higher-end jobs are less common but are handled by experienced local service providers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are signs that a metal roof needs replacement? Indicators include visible rust, significant leaks, damaged panels, or widespread corrosion that cannot be repaired effectively.
Can existing roofing materials be reused during a metal roof replacement? Typically, existing roofing is removed to ensure proper installation of the new metal roofing, but this can vary based on the condition of the current roof.
What should I consider when choosing a contractor for metal roof replacement? It's important to look for experienced local service providers with good reputations, proper insurance, and a focus on quality workmanship.
Are there different types of metal roofing materials available for replacement? Yes, options include steel, aluminum, copper, and zinc, each offering different benefits and aesthetic qualities.
Is it necessary to obtain permits for a metal roof replacement? Permit requirements depend on local building codes; contacting local service providers can help determine what's needed in the area.
